Journal Descriptions

Epigenetics publishes international research into heritable changes in gene expression caused by mechanisms other than the modification of the DNA sequence. The journal considers submissions that investigate how environmental factors via epigenetic mechanisms and how epigenetic mechanisms themselves can influence gene expression and diverse biological functions to exert their role in disease, aging, and developmental processes. This includes everything from research into epigenetic mechanisms (e.g., nucleosome positioning, DNA methylation, histone covalent modifications, non-coding RNAs, imprinting to chromatin remodelling complexes, and epigenetic RNA modifications-epitranscriptomics), and the role of epigenetics in life, health, and disease, including epigenetic therapy and diagnostics. Epigenetics, as a leading journal in the field, provides a platform for presenting and discussing cutting-edge epigentic research.
